Abstract

The research aims to develop a play program to develop some basic motor skills in kindergarten children, as well as to identify the effect of a play program on developing some basic motor skills in kindergarten children.

The research community was defined as kindergarten children (4-5 years old), male and female, in the center of Babil Governorate for the year 2024-2025. The main experimental sample was represented by the children of Al-Amani Kindergarten, after they were randomly selected from the original research community by lottery. The sample numbered (50) male and female children, distributed into two groups: (28) children in group (A), and (22) children in group (B), totaling (50) children, both male and female. The researcher used appropriate research devices and tools for the research procedures, followed by statistical processing, presentation, and discussion of the results. The researcher reached several conclusions, the most important of which was that the use of a play program directly and significantly impacted the effectiveness of the children's performance, which led to the development of the basic motor skills that were the subject of the research. In addition, the results achieved by the tests demonstrated the validity of the educational units prepared by the researcher through the clear development of basic motor skills.
